Best Times to Visit Refugio Nacional de Vida Silvestre Gandoca-Manzanillo

When should you plan your Vacation Rentals stay?

To make the most of your stay in this vibrant destination, consider visiting during the dry season from January to April when the weather is typically sunny and ideal for exploring the natural beauty and wildlife of the region.

Peak Season Highlights

spring
December to April

During the dry season, you'll enjoy clear skies and minimal rainfall, making it an ideal time to explore this destination.

Average Temperature Daytime: 30°C - Nighttime: 22°C
spring
July to August

The region experiences a secondary peak with warm weather and lively local activities, perfect for outdoor adventures.

Average Temperature Daytime: 31°C - Nighttime: 23°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
May to June

During these months, you might encounter increased rain, but the lush scenery and fewer visitors create a peaceful atmosphere.

Average Temperature Daytime: 29°C - Nighttime: 21°C
image
September to November

This period sees the highest rainfall, yet it offers vibrant wildlife and a quieter environment for those seeking tranquility.

Average Temperature Daytime: 28°C - Nighttime: 20°C
